The Last Seduction
on DVD
(1994)
Starring: Linda Fiorentino, Peter Berg, Bill Pullman
Director: John Dahl
Certificate: 
The director of "Red Rock West" delivers this unusual thriller about a femme fatale who absconds with her husband's drug money. Fiorentino is enchantingly wicked as the cold-blooded beauty who uses men like toys.

Kill Me Again
on DVD
(1990)
Starring: Joanne Whalley, Michael Madsen, Jonathan Gries
Director: John Dahl
Certificate: 
The double crosses begin early when Fay knocks out her boyfriend and runs off with the money they stole from the Mob. She hires Jack to fake her death, but when Fay skips out on him too, he pursues her, setting himself up against the law, her ex-boyfriend and the Mob.
